What are the top most famous quotes by Aeschylus?

Here are the top most famous quotes by Aeschylus.

  • By Time and Age full many things are taught.
  • Wisdom comes alone through suffering.
  • It is best for the wise man not to seem wise.
  • To be free from evil thoughts is God's best gift.
  • Call no man happy till he is dead.
  • Of all the gods only death does not desire gifts.
  • Death is easier than a wretched life and better never to have born than to live and fare badly.
  • I know how men in exile feed on dreams.
  • I'm not afraid of storms, for I'm learning to sail my ship.
  • It is always in season for old men to learn.
